Digital marketing isn’t about who spends the most.
It’s about who stays most consistent.
Consistency helps algorithms, audiences, and funnels understand your brand.
When you show up regularly, your performance stabilizes and improves.
The biggest mistake businesses make is sporadic marketing:
Posting irregularly
Running ads only when sales drop
Updating SEO once in months
Doing big pushes followed by long gaps
This kills momentum.
Algorithms reward patterns.
Audiences respond to consistency.
Funnels only optimize with continuous data.
“Momentum compounds more than money.”
Consistency compounds in three main areas:
1. SEO
Publishing regularly signals freshness and authority.
2. Paid Ads
Algorithms optimize based on continuous data flow.
Stop-start campaigns reset learning.
3. Social Media
People trust brands they see consistently.
Even small actions — weekly ads, monthly blogs, daily posts — outperform large inconsistent bursts.
Consistency builds trust, improves recall, and increases conversions without increasing budget.
